Jordan and Argentina meet in the final round of the World Cup 2026 group stage. The match takes place this Sunday, 28 June, at 3 AM (BST) at AT&T Stadium in Arlington.
With two wins from two, Argentina have already booked their place in the knockout stages, while Jordan have been eliminated after two defeats. The South Americans will be looking to maintain their perfect record, while their opponents will simply be playing for pride in this Jordan vs. Argentina clash.

Jordan vs. Argentina - Head-to-head record
This World Cup group stage clash marks an unprecedented encounter for both nations. Jordan and Argentina have never faced each other in a senior international match, meaning there is no prior record to draw upon. The game in Dallas will be the initial meeting between these two teams.
The Jordan vs. Argentina fixture pits a global football giant and reigning champion against a nation making its debut on the world’s biggest stage. This represents a true step into the unknown for both sides and their supporters.

Recent form
Jordan’s World Cup debut ended quickly, with the team eliminated after just two matches. They suffered a 3-1 defeat to Austria and then a 2-1 loss against Algeria, despite scoring first in the latter game. Conceding five goals while only scoring two highlights their struggles against experienced opposition.
This tough tournament run follows a period of poor form in 2026. Before the World Cup, Jordan failed to win any of their four friendly matches, recording two draws and two defeats. This contrasts sharply with their strong performance in the 2025 Arab Cup, where they reached the final.
Despite the challenging results, midfielder Nizar Al-Rashdan and attacker Ali Olwan have both scored, demonstrating their attacking potential. Sabra is the only unavailable player for this encounter. Recent form
Argentina enter this match in unstoppable form, having already secured their place in the knockout stages. They have been dominant in the World Cup, winning their opening two games against Algeria (3-0) and Austria (2-0). The team has been firing on all cylinders, scoring five goals without conceding a single one.
The standout performer has been Lionel Messi, who is in sensational goalscoring touch. The forward has found the back of the net five times in just two matches, becoming the World Cup’s all-time leading scorer in the process. At the other end, goalkeeper Emiliano Martínez has been a rock, keeping two clean sheets.
Overall, Argentina are on an impressive nine-match winning streak across all competitions. With qualification guaranteed, the coach may choose to rest some key players for the Jordan vs. Argentina game. However, even with potential squad rotation, their quality and confidence make them formidable opponents for the already-eliminated Jordan.
